    So, What Is RPA?

    RPA is a fancy term for software bots that do repetitive computer tasks for you. Think of them like super-reliable digital assistants that never sleep, never forget, and never get bored.

    These bots can:

    • Copy and paste data between spreadsheets and CRMs
    • Send emails with personalized messages
    • Schedule appointments or follow-ups
    • Automatically generate reports
    • Handle form submissions and notifications

    Why Does This Matter to Small Business Owners?

    Because your time is limited. You’re the CEO, the marketer, the customer support, the admin… and probably also the janitor. RPA helps by offloading those time-consuming, boring-but-important tasks so you can focus on growth, service, or even just catching your breath.

    It’s Not Just for Big Companies

    In fact, small businesses get the most bang for their buck because every hour saved is critical. With the right setup, a simple bot can save you 5–10 hours a week or more. That’s time you can reinvest into sales, strategy, or taking Friday off.
